Title: Air-Fryer Fish & Chips
Categories: Seafood. po, Cheese, Grains, Chilies
Yield: 4 Servings
1 lb Potatoes
2 tb Olive oil
1/4 ts Pepper
1/4 ts Salt
MMMMM----------------------------FISH---------------------------------
1/3 c A-P flour
1/4 ts Pepper
1 lg Egg
2 tb Water
2/3 c Cornflakes; crushed
1 tb Parmesan cheese; grated
1/8 ts Cayenne pepper
1 lb Haddock or cod fillets
1/4 ts Salt
Tartar sauce (optional)
Heat air fryer to 400 F/205 C.
Peel and cut potatoes lengthwise into 1/2" thick slices; cut slices
into 1/2" thick sticks.
In a large bowl, toss potatoes with oil, pepper, and salt. Working
in batches, place potatoes in a single layer on tray in air-fryer
basket; cook until just tender, 5 to 10 minutes Toss potatoes to
redistribute; cook until lightly browned and crisp, 5 to 10 minutes
longer.
Meanwhile, in a shallow bowl, mix flour and pepper. In another
shallow bowl, whisk egg with water. In a 3rd bowl, toss cornflakes
with cheese and cayenne. Sprinkle fish with salt. Dip into flour
mixture to coat both sides; shake off excess. Dip in egg mixture,
then in cornflake mixture, patting to help coating adhere.
Remove fries from basket; keep warm. Place fish in a single layer
on tray in air-fryer basket. Cook until fish is lightly browned and
just beginning to flake easily with a fork, 8 to 10 minutes,
turning halfway through cooking. Do not overcook. Return fries to
basket to heat through. Serve immediately. If desired, serve with
tartar sauce.
